Abstract :
Digital data messages are very important in modern communication systems and the advanced data technologies that rely on the Internet protocol have opened the door to a wide range of IP-based applications and services. With this trend in mind, we have implemented a system that will allow smaller law enforcement agencies to enable data services in their cruisers in a cost effective way, with a high level of reliability. Towards this goal, we have implemented an inexpensive software defined APCO Project 25 Data Base Station that utilizes the standard IP network interface. This paper describes the overall design of the data base station, its implementation in the preexisting radio network infrastructure, and the testing process. Laboratory tests have produced promising and encouraging results prior to real world deployment.
